Let's suppose that accusations of plagiarism never bombard Senator Joe Biden's 1988 presidential campaign in September 1987 and because of it, Senator Biden continues his run for the White House without any other controversies. Come to the Democratic Convention in Atlanta, Georgia, Senator Biden wins almost unanimously on the first ballot after blitzing his opposition throughout the 1988 Democratic primaries.

Thus, this leads me to ask, how would the 1988 Presidential Election turn out if these were the tickets nominated by both the Republican ticket led by Vice President George Bush, and the Democratic ticket led by Senator Joe Biden.

Republican
Vice President George H.W. Bush of Texas
Senator J. Danforth Quayle of Indiana

Democratic
Senator Joseph R. Biden of Delaware
Senator Bob Graham of Florida

How would this Bush/Biden match up turn out in 1988? Discuss with EV maps if you wish.
